I experienced a similar issue with Numbers files which were only stored locally on my iPad Air after updating to iOS 11.1.1. The files appeared to be there in the list when viewed through Numbers and through the Files app, but when you selected a file it would not open. When I attempted to create copy of the file, a message appeared that the file could not be found. I checked the files in Pages and they seemed to open without issue.


I thought all was lost too, but because the Numbers file names were visible I thought I would attempt to access them from my computer. This is what I did. . .


  1. Connected my iPad to my Windows PC. When iTunes opened and started the sync process I cancelled it immediately (just in case I had to restore from the last backup)
  2. Select the iPad icon in the top bar, beneath the Player controls.User uploaded file.
  3. Select File Sharing from below the Settings menu.
    User uploaded file
  4. Select Numbers from the list of Apps. If your files are still on your device, they will appear in the list of Numbers documents.
  5. Select all of your documents. Click "Save to..." at the bottom of the list. Create a folder on your computer and click "Select Folder" to save the files. You'll see the status of the files being copied appear at in the status bar of iTunes.
  6. When the copying process is complete locate the folder on your computer and open it using file explorer.
  7. Create copies of the files you want to open on your iPad. Rename them with the word "Copy" added to the file name. (this steps appears to be critical, I tried to replace the original file on the iPad by copying back the same file without renaming it and the file disappeared from the list of Numbers files on my iPad, even though it still appears in the list of Numbers Documents on the iPad when I look at it through iTunes.)
  8. Go back to iTunes and select "Add File...". Select the copies you just created. Click Open. They will be transferred to your iPad.
  9. Open Numbers on your iPad and select one of the copied files. It should open. Once you confirm it has opened you can delete the one that would not open.


I am assuming that if you follow the same procedure for your missing Pages files it will work, but let me know whether or not it does.


While it is frustrating that iOS 11 has this bug of the disappearing files, at least with this work-around, you won't loose all your hard work :-) You can access the files now, without having to wait for Apple to discover the problem and issue a solution.
